Abstract: Se propuso la realización de un PLAN RECTOR Y DISEÑO CONCEPTUAL DE
RED DE CICLOVÍAS PARA EL DISTRITO DE PIURA con el propósito de determinar la
aceptación o no de la implementación del sistema de BICICLETA PUBLICA como un medio
alternativo de transporte en las áreas urbanas del distrito de Piura provincia de Piura.
Si bien la metodología propuesta de un Plan Rector y Diseño Conceptual de Red
de Ciclo vías es aplicable en cualquier ciudad, para efecto de este trabajo y como caso de
estudio se eligió el Distrito de Piura.
Previo al planteamiento de la metodología se investiga la situación actual del
transporte público, privado y en especial como poder implementar las ciclovías para lograr
así fomentar la utilización de la BICICLETA con sus beneficios y posibles desventajas;
considerando la Reglamentación y Normas Técnicas existentes.
además, consideramos los fundamentos de la Ingeniería de Tránsito e Ingeniería
de Transporte, y partiendo de la investigación de las ENCUESTAS DE MOVILIDAD que,
en general, permiten obtener información del comportamiento en cuanto a desplazamientos
de la población y herramientas de análisis de sus tendencias para la planificación de la
movilidad en los diferentes territorios, estudiaremos las Encuestas de Preferencias,
DECLARADAS Y REVELADAS, con sus experiencias a nivel nacional e internacional, lo
que permite que el presente trabajo esté fundamentado en una base teórica y legal
coherente.
El procedimiento de aplicación de la METODOLOGÍA PROPUESTA y que se
utilizó en el caso de estudio, comprende en síntesis tres etapas: Análisis y Diagnóstico;
Desarrollo y Aplicación; y, Evaluación y Estadística, para terminar con Conclusiones y
Recomendaciones
Al iniciar se determinan los OBJETIVOS DEL ESTUDIO, se realiza el DISEÑO
DE LAS ENCUESTAS con las preguntas orientadas a obtener la información para lograr
esos objetivos; se define la ZONA DE ESTUDIO en base a la población del distrito de Piura,
uso de suelo y los sitios donde existe más desplazamientos hacia el centro de la ciudad, los
que nos orientara para determinar los circuitos de ciclovias que se pueden proponer en el
plan rector y diseño conceptual de la red de ciclovias.
En la etapa siguiente, una vez desarrollado y probado el diseño de las encuestas se
definió el TAMAÑO DE LA MUESTRA, número de encuestas a realizarse o personas a
encuestar, en la cual se consideró la Población de la Zona Definida, el Porcentaje de
Confiabilidad y el Porcentaje de Error Permitido; para aplicar las encuestas, TRABAJO DE
CAMPO, se designó el número de encuestadores y se desarrollaron las encuestas en días y
horas laborables; realizadas estas, fueron recolectadas, CONTABILIZADAS y sus
resultados CODIFICADOS e ingresados en la base de datos para su posterior
EVALUACIÓN
En la última etapa, se procedió al ANÁLISIS y DETERMINACIÓN de
CONCLUSIONES, para conocer no solo cuántos encuestados existieron de la muestra
utilizada sino cuántos del total de la población de la zona elegida estarían de acuerdo o no
con la implementación del plan rector para la red de ciclovias en el distrito de Piura.
it is proposed from transit engineering or transport engineering to develop a proposal for the realization of a master plan and conceptual design of cycle-cycle network for the district of Piura, taking into account the importance of data collection and field data collection; for the purpose of determining whether or not to accept the implementation of the public bicycle system as an alternative means of transport in the urban areas of the district of Piura province of Piura. Although the proposed methodology of a master plan and conceptual design of cycle network pathways is applicable in any city, for effect of this work and as a case study the district of Piura was chosen. Although the proposed methodology of a Master Plan and Conceptual Design of Network Cycle Pathways is applicable in any city, for effect of this work and as case study was chosen the District of Piura. Prior to the proposed methodology, the current situation of public transport is investigated, in particular how to implement the Cycle Lanes in order to promote the use of the BICYCLE with its benefits and possible disadvantages; considering the existing Regulations and Technical Standards. In addition, we consider the foundations of Transit Engineering and Transport Engineering, and starting from the research of MOBILITY SURVEYS that, in general, they provide information on the behaviour of population movements and tools for analysing trends in the planning of mobility in the different territories, We will study the Preferences Surveys, DECLARED AND REVEALED, with their experiences at national and international level, which allows the present work to be based on a coherent theoretical and legal basis. The procedure of application of the PROPOSED METHODOLOGY, which was used in the case of the study, comprises in synthesis three stages: Analysis and Diagnosis; Development and Application; and, Evaluation and Statistics, to conclude with Conclusions and Recommendations. In the first stage, the OBJECTIVES OF THE STUDY are determined, the DESIGN OF THE SURVEYS is carried out with the questions aimed at obtaining the information to achieve these objectives; the STUDY AREA is defined on the basis of the population of the district of Piura, land use and the sites where there are more displacements towards the city center, those that will guide us to determine the cycling circuits that can be proposed in the master plan and conceptual design of the cycling network. In the next stage, once the design of the surveys has been developed and tested, the SAMPLE SIZE, the number of surveys to be carried out or the persons to be surveyed, in which the Population of the Defined Area was considered, the Percentage of Reliability and the Percentage of Error Allowed; to apply the surveys, FIELD WORK, the number of pollsters was designated and the surveys were developed in working days and hours; carried out, they were collected, COUNTED and their results CODED and entered in the database for subsequent EVALUATION. In the last stage, we proceed to the ANALYSIS and DETERMINATION of CONCLUSIONS, to find out not only how many respondents there were in the sample used, but how many of the total population in the chosen area would or would not agree with the implementation of the master plan for the Piura district cycling network.
